Transaction 22977aaa707a09aead66cffd664d093f94b040a583bd9f3ecfcfc9f7f2378eaa
1 Input
1 Output
-
22977aaa707a09aead66cffd664d093f94b040a583bd9f3ecfcfc9f7f2378eaa:0
- value
- 108663
- script pubkey
- OP_0 OP_PUSHBYTES_20 8622b23b9a0b4105c522bb4ae41ea8705e866888
- address
- bc1qsc3tywu6pdqst3fzhd9wg84gwp0gv6yg7a4u7c